Sec. 08.07.01.01. Definitions  


Latest version.
  • A. In this chapter, the following terms have the meanings indicated.

    B. Terms Defined.

    (1) “Commissioned officer” means a forest or park warden, or a forest or park ranger, having the authority stated in Natural Resources Article, §5-206, Annotated Code of Maryland, or a Natural Resources police officer having the authority stated in Natural Resources Article, §1-204, Annotated Code of Maryland.

    (2) "Department" means the Department of Natural Resources.

    (3) "Developed areas" means those areas within a State forest having permanent facilities and the areas surrounding those facilities.

    (4) “Director” means the Director of the Department of Natural Resources - Forest Service, or the Director’s authorized representative.

    (5) “Fireworks” means combustible, implosive, or explosive compositions, substances, combinations of substances, or articles that are prepared to produce a visible or audible effect by combustion, explosion, implosion, deflagration, or denotation.

    (6) Forest Officer.

    (a) "Forest officer" means a commissioned officer.

    (b) "Forest officer" includes:

    (i) Forest manager;

    (ii) Rangers; and

    (iii) Other personnel employed by the State to manage and regulate the use of the State forest.

    (7) Off-Road Vehicle.

    (a) "Off-road vehicle" means a motorized vehicle designed for or capable of cross-country travel on land, water, snow, ice, marsh, swampland, or other natural terrain.

    (b) "Off-road vehicle" includes:

    (i) A four-wheel drive or low pressure tire vehicle;

    (ii) Automobiles;

    (iii) Trucks;

    (iv) Motorcycles and related two-wheel vehicles;

    (v) Amphibious machines;

    (vi) Ground effect or air cushion vehicles; and

    (vii) Snowmobiles.

    (8) “Service” means the Department of Natural Resources - Forest Service.

    (9) "State forest road" means a road on or adjacent to the State forest maintained or constructed and maintained by the Service.

    (10) "Undeveloped areas" means those areas within a State forest not having permanent facilities.

    (11) Vehicle.

    (a) "Vehicle" means a mode of transportation by which an individual or property may be transported on a waterway or highway.

    (b) "Vehicle" includes:

    (i) Vessels;

    (ii) Trailers;

    (iii) Automobiles;

    (iv) Trucks;

    (v) Buses;

    (vi) Mopeds;

    (vii) Animals;

    (viii) Animal-drawn vehicles; and

    (ix) Bicycles.

    (12) Vessel.

    (a) "Vessel" means any type of watercraft, other than a seaplane, used or capable of being used as a means of transportation on water or ice.

    (b) "Vessel" includes:

    (i) The vessel's motor, spars, sails, and accessories; and

    (ii) Ice boats.
